dc.description.abstractAllergic rhinitis is an increasing burden for our society from the patients point of perspective as well as from the economics perspective. For the treatment the approach has to be separated into disease modifying and non-modifying. Disease modifying Immunotherapy and its basic concept is known for more than 100 years and offers the only way to lower the risk of future development of asthma. Subcutaneous immunotherapy (SCIT) is already well established, but in the last couple decades the research lead to an alternative sublingual immunotherapy (SLIT). Ongoing research in order to improve the safety and efficacy of immunotherapy, as well as to improve convenience and tolerance for patients, lead to tablet based SLIT and shorter course SCIT alternatives and many more approaches. This continuous research is a necessity and promises a much faster evolving immunotherapy then it did in the past.hu_HU
